Fishing Report Alto Parana – February 2017

This season the Parana River ran slightly lower than usual for many weeks, so the water has been clear and warm. Those same conditions have helped concentrate dorado in faster, oxygenated riffles. Fish have also been more active in early and later hours.

Pira pita and pacu fishing has been a more technical game, requiring long, accurate casts and perfect presentations with longer leaders. Sight-fishing opportunities in the clear water have also been great. The fruit hatch has started, with fish snacks falling from most of the trees. Both fruit flies and terrestrial imitations continue to be effective.
